Course Goal / Objective

The objective of this course is to gain basic knowledge and skills to students about dilution and the disk diffusion method to detect in vitro susceptibility to antibiotics of bacteria

Course Content

Antibiotics and general properties of antibiotics, antibiotic susceptibility tests, dilution methods, antibiotic resistance of bacteria.

Course Learning Outcomes

Order Course Learning Outcomes
LO01 Learning the importance of antibiotic susceptibility testing
LO02 Learning Mechanisms of effect of antibiotics
LO03 Classify and interpret antibiotic susceptibility tests.
LO04 Learning Antibiotic resistance mechanisms
LO05 Describe effective in preventing development of antibiotic resistance and antibiotic usage patterns.
